Embodiment 1

[0050] refer to figure 1 , this embodiment discloses a wireless power supply NOMA system, which includes an energy tower PB, a source S, a security-demanding user U1, a reliability-demanding user U2, and M eavesdroppers Em(m∈{1,...,M }), where PB is equipped with N antennas, and other nodes are equipped with single antennas, and the working mode of all nodes is half-duplex; Em tries to eavesdrop on the signal of U1.

[0051] In the following, the communication process is divided into two time periods of energy collection and information transmission, and the working process of the system in each time period is described respectively:

[0052] energy harvesting stage

[0053] 1) PB uses the maximum ratio transmission (MRT) method to send radio frequency signals to S within θT time (θ represents the time ratio of energy collection and information transmission), and the energy collected by S can be expressed as:

[0054] E=ηθTP 0 ||h bs w|| 2 =ηθTP 0 ||h bs || 2

Abstract

The invention belongs to the technical field of wireless communication, and discloses a wireless power supply non-orthogonal multiple access (NOMA) safety transmission method and system combining artificial noise and power distribution; for an NOMA system with an eavesdropper, in an energy collection stage, a signal source obtains energy from an energy tower by using an energy collection technology; and in the information transmission stage, the information source sends superposed coded signals to the two users. In an information transmission stage, a dynamic power distribution method is adopted to ensure that a reliable demand user can successfully decode, a security demand user can successfully eliminate serial interference, and meanwhile, an energy tower sends artificial noise to deteriorate the receiving quality of an eavesdropper, so that security transmission between an information source and the security demand user is ensured. Compared with a traditional wireless power supply NOMA system transmission method, the reliability and safety of the system are remarkably improved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of wireless communication, and in particular relates to a NOMA safe transmission method and system combining artificial noise and power distribution. Background technique [0002] In order to improve the spectrum efficiency and energy efficiency of future wireless networks, Non-Orthogonal Multiple Access (NOMA) technology and wireless power transmission have attracted extensive attention in the industry. NOMA technology is considered to be a very promising multiple access method in the 5G and post-5G era. Among them, the power domain NOMA technology has received extensive attention due to its low implementation complexity and high compatibility.
